{"id":809,"date":"2025-08-14T18:55:30","date_gmt":"2025-08-14T18:55:30","guid":{"rendered":"https:\/\/proteus-analytics.com\/?page_id=809"},"modified":"2025-08-25T22:30:07","modified_gmt":"2025-08-25T22:30:07","slug":"blog","status":"publish","type":"page","link":"https:\/\/proteus-analytics.com\/index.php\/blog\/","title":{"rendered":"Blog"},"content":{"rendered":"<p><!doctype html><br \/>\n<html lang=\"en\"><br \/>\n<head><br \/>\n<meta charset=\"utf-8\"><meta name=\"viewport\" content=\"width=device-width, initial-scale=1\">\n<link href=\"https:\/\/fonts.googleapis.com\/css2?family=EB+Garamond:wght@600;700&display=swap\" rel=\"stylesheet\">\n<style>\n  :root{\n    --bg:#fff; --text:#0f172a; --muted:#475569; --card:#ffffff; --bord:#e2e8f0;\n    --shadow: 0 8px 30px rgba(2,6,23,.10);\n    --accent:#0ea5e9; --accent-2:#14b8a6; --warn:#f59e0b; --hold:#94a3b8;\n    --radius:18px; --gap:18px; --pad:18px; --maxw:1100px;\n  }\n  @media (prefers-color-scheme: dark){\n    :root{ --bg:#0b1220; --text:#e5e7eb; --muted:#9aa4b2; --card:#0f172a; --bord:#1f2937; --shadow: 0 10px 36px rgba(0,0,0,.45); }\n  }\n  body{ margin:0; background:var(--bg); color:var(--text); font: 16px\/1.55 ui-sans-serif, system-ui, -apple-system, Segoe UI, Roboto, Helvetica, Arial, \"Apple Color Emoji\", \"Segoe UI Emoji\"; }\n  .pa-wrap{ max-width:var(--maxw); margin:auto; padding: clamp(16px, 3vw, 28px); }\n  h1,h2,h3{ font-family:'EB Garamond', ui-serif, Georgia, 'Times New Roman', serif; letter-spacing:.2px; margin: 0 0 .6em; }\n  h1{ font-size: clamp(34px, 6vw, 52px); }\n  h2{ font-size: clamp(24px, 3.4vw, 34px); }\n  p{ margin:.6em 0 1em; color: var(--text); }\n  .muted{ color: var(--muted); }\n  .pa-hero{ margin-bottom: 18px; padding: clamp(8px, 2vw, 12px) 0; }\n  .pa-hero p{ font-size: clamp(16px, 2.2vw, 18px); }\n  .pa-grid{ display:grid; gap:var(--gap); grid-template-columns: repeat(1, minmax(0,1fr)); }\n  @media(min-width:680px){ .pa-grid{ grid-template-columns: repeat(2, minmax(0,1fr)); } }\n  @media(min-width:1024px){ .pa-grid{ grid-template-columns: repeat(3, minmax(0,1fr)); } }\n  .pa-card{ background:var(--card); border:1px solid var(--bord); border-radius:var(--radius);\n            padding:var(--pad); box-shadow: var(--shadow); transition: transform .18s ease, box-shadow .18s ease; }\n  .pa-card:hover{ transform: translateY(-3px); box-shadow: 0 16px 40px rgba(2,6,23,.15); }\n  .pa-card h3{ margin-top:0; margin-bottom:.4em; font-size: 20px; }\n  .pa-btn{ display:inline-block; border-radius: 14px; border:1px solid var(--bord); padding:10px 14px; text-decoration:none; font-weight:600; }\n  .is-accent{ background:var(--accent); color:white; border-color: transparent; }\n  .is-ghost{ background:transparent; color:var(--text); }\n  .pa-chips{ display:flex; flex-wrap:wrap; gap:8px; margin-top:.5rem; }\n  .pa-chip{ font-size: 12px; padding:6px 10px; border-radius: 999px; border:1px solid var(--bord); background: rgba(14,165,233,.08); }\n  img.pa-thumb{ width:100%; height:190px; object-fit:cover; border-radius: calc(var(--radius) - 4px); border:1px solid var(--bord); }\n  .pa-two{ display:grid; grid-template-columns: 1fr; gap:var(--gap); }\n  @media(min-width:900px){ .pa-two{ grid-template-columns: 1.1fr .9fr; } }\n  .pa-list{ list-style:none; padding:0; margin:0; display:grid; gap:12px; }\n  .pa-list li{ padding:12px; border:1px dashed var(--bord); border-radius: 12px; }\n  .pa-kicker{ font-size:13px; text-transform:uppercase; letter-spacing:.16em; color:var(--muted); }\n  .pa-foot{ margin-top: 26px; font-size: 13px; color: var(--muted); }\n  .pa-hr{ height:1px; background:var(--bord); border:none; margin: 16px 0 24px; }\n<\/style>\n<p><title>Blog \u2014 Proteus Analytics<\/title><br \/>\n<\/head><br \/>\n<body><br \/>\n  <main class=\"pa-wrap\"><\/p>\n<section class=\"pa-hero\">\n<div class=\"pa-kicker\">Blog<\/div>\n<h1>Notes, walkthroughs, and experiments<\/h1>\n<p class=\"muted\">Short, pointed posts tied to code or math. The list below is a manual index; your WordPress loop will replace this.<\/p>\n<\/section>\n<section class=\"pa-grid\">\n<article class=\"pa-card\">\n<h3>Countable and Uncountable Infinities<\/h3>\n<p class=\"muted\">A fast tour of diagonalization, measure-zero traps, and \u201csize.\u201d<\/p>\n<p>        <a class=\"pa-btn is-accent\" href=\"\/posts\/countable-uncountable\">Read<\/a><br \/>\n      <\/article>\n<article class=\"pa-card\">\n<h3>CVODE with the Robertson Problem<\/h3>\n<p class=\"muted\">From build flags to Jacobian choices; reproducible baseline.<\/p>\n<p>        <a class=\"pa-btn is-accent\" href=\"\/posts\/cvode-robertson\">Read<\/a><br \/>\n      <\/article>\n<article class=\"pa-card\">\n<h3>On Generating True Random Numbers<\/h3>\n<p class=\"muted\">Entropy sources, bias correction, and test batteries.<\/p>\n<p>        <a class=\"pa-btn is-accent\" href=\"\/posts\/true-rng\">Read<\/a><br \/>\n      <\/article>\n<\/section>\n<p class=\"pa-foot\">If using WP: drop this in a static page or let your theme render the archive instead.<\/p>\n<p>  <\/main><br \/>\n<\/body><br \/>\n<\/html><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Blog \u2014 Proteus Analytics Blog Notes, walkthroughs, and experiments Short, pointed posts tied to code or math. The list below is a<\/p>\n<p class=\"link-more\"><a class=\"myButt \" href=\"https:\/\/proteus-analytics.com\/index.php\/blog\/\">Read More<\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"parent":0,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_eb_attr":"","footnotes":""},"class_list":["post-809","page","type-page","status-publish","hentry"],"_links":{"self":[{"href":"https:\/\/proteus-analytics.com\/index.php\/wp-json\/wp\/v2\/pages\/809","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/proteus-analytics.com\/index.php\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/proteus-analytics.com\/index.php\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/proteus-analytics.com\/index.php\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/proteus-analytics.com\/index.php\/wp-json\/wp\/v2\/comments?post=809"}],"version-history":[{"count":3,"href":"https:\/\/proteus-analytics.com\/index.php\/wp-json\/wp\/v2\/pages\/809\/revisions"}],"predecessor-version":[{"id":938,"href":"https:\/\/proteus-analytics.com\/index.php\/wp-json\/wp\/v2\/pages\/809\/revisions\/938"}],"wp:attachment":[{"href":"https:\/\/proteus-analytics.com\/index.php\/wp-json\/wp\/v2\/media?parent=809"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}